Albert Sieber Obituary

Albert Sieber, 91, died on March 30, 2011, in Lecanto, Fla. He graduated from Morristown High School in 1938. Al joined the Army in N.J., in September 1943. He saw action with Merrill's Marauders in Burma. He received the Combat Infantry Badge, the Purple Heart, Bronze Star, Presidential Unit Citation, Asiatic, Pacific, Good Conduct and World War II Victory medals.
Al met his wife, Dottie, working at Bloomingdale's in Short Hills, N.J., and married in 1974. After living in N.J., they moved to Sugarmill Woods in Homosassa, Florida. He and his wife were members of the West Citrus Elks Lodge 2693.
He is survived by his wife, and his daughters, Andrea Means, her husband Paul, and their son Guy Pronesti, and Claudia Slater, and her two children, Reed and Tara Slater; and his brother, George and wife Anita, and two nieces and two nephews.
